mes软件系统底层架构
-
MES(Manufacturing Execution System)是制造业中常用的生产执行系统,用于实时监控和管理生产过程。MES系统的底层架构是一个相当复杂的系统,它涉及到数据库管理、用户界面、数据采集、设备集成等方面。下面将从不同角度解释MES系统的底层架构。
1. 数据库管理
MES系统的底层架构首先涉及数据库管理,数据在制造过程中起着关键作用,而数据库是存储和管理这些重要数据的关键组成部分。MES系统通常会采用关系数据库管理系统(RDBMS)来存储生产订单、工艺路线、设备状态、质量数据等信息。数据库中的结构设计需要符合企业的生产特点,同时支持系统的高效运行和数据的快速查询。
2. 操作系统
MES系统需要在各种硬件平台上运行,因此需要考虑不同操作系统的兼容性。通常MES系统会支持多种操作系统,如Windows、Linux等,以便在不同的硬件环境中运行。
3. 通信与数据采集
MES系统需要与各种设备进行通信,并实时采集生产数据。因此,底层架构中会包含用于数据通信和采集的模块,例如PLC(可编程逻辑控制器)连接模块、传感器数据采集模块等。这些模块需要能够与各种不同类型的设备进行通讯,并将数据传输到MES系统中进行处理和分析。
4. 业务逻辑与应用层
MES系统的底层架构中还包含业务逻辑和应用层,这部分通常是系统的核心。它包括生产调度、质量管理、物料追踪、报表生成、计划排程等功能。这些业务逻辑和应用层需要能够对接上层的ERP系统,与设备及人员进行有效连接与调度。
5. 用户界面
用户界面是MES系统中与用户直接交互的部分,底层架构中会包含用户界面设计和实现,以及与应用层之间的交互。用户界面通常包括了生产监控界面、报表查看界面、人员管理界面等,为用户提供操作、监控和管理生产过程的能力。
MES系统的底层架构是一个复杂的系统工程,需要考虑到数据库管理、操作系统兼容性、通信与数据采集、业务逻辑与应用层、用户界面等多个方面。这些组成部分相互配合,共同构成了一个高效稳定的MES系统。
1年前 -
MES(Manufacturing Execution System,制造执行系统)是指将计算机技术和软件工具应用到制造过程中,以实现生产过程的监控、协调和管理的系统。MES系统的底层架构一般包括硬件层、操作系统层、数据库层、应用层和接口层等部分。下面我们来详细介绍MES软件系统的底层架构:
-
硬件层:MES系统的硬件层是指用于支撑系统运行的硬件设备,包括服务器、网络设备、工作站、传感器、PLC(可编程逻辑控制器)等。服务器负责存储和处理数据,网络设备用于设备间通信,工作站用于人机交互操作,传感器和PLC用于采集和控制生产过程中的数据。
-
操作系统层:MES系统的操作系统层是指安装在硬件设备上的操作系统,通常选择稳定、高效的操作系统,如Windows Server、Linux等。操作系统负责管理硬件资源、运行应用程序和提供系统服务。
-
数据库层:MES系统的数据库层用于存储和管理生产过程中产生的各种数据,包括生产订单、工艺路线、物料清单、设备状态、质量数据等。常用的数据库软件包括Oracle、SQL Server、MySQL等,用于数据的持久化存储和快速检索。
-
应用层:MES系统的应用层是系统的核心部分,包括各种功能模块和业务逻辑,如生产计划排程、工单管理、物料追溯、质量管理、设备维护等。应用层通过与数据库层交互,实现数据的处理和业务流程的控制,为用户提供生产过程的监控、执行和分析功能。
-
接口层:MES系统的接口层包括与其他系统的对接接口,如与ERP系统、设备控制系统、质量管理系统等的接口。通过与其他系统的集成,实现信息的共享和业务流程的协同,提高生产效率和质量。
除了以上几个主要的层外,MES系统还可能包括报表生成模块、移动终端应用、数据采集模块等其他组件,以满足不同用户的需求。总的来说,MES系统的底层架构是一个复杂的系统工程,需要硬件、软件和各种技术手段的有机结合,以实现对生产过程的精细管理和控制。
1年前 -
-
MES (Manufacturing Execution System) 软件系统是用于监控、管理和优化制造过程的关键工具。它在现代制造业中扮演着至关重要的角色,能够帮助企业提高生产效率、优化资源利用、降低生产成本,最终提升整体竞争力。MES 软件系统的底层架构是其实现功能和性能的关键,下面将详细介绍 MES 软件系统的底层架构。
-
数据库层:
典型的 MES 软件系统是基于数据库来存储和管理生产过程中的各种数据和信息的。数据库层是 MES 系统底层架构中的核心部分,它通常会采用关系型数据库如Oracle、SQL Server等,也有一些系统会采用NoSQL数据库来存储大规模数据。数据库层负责数据的存储、管理、检索和更新,是 MES 系统实现数据持久化和高效访问的基础。 -
集成层:
MES 软件系统需要与企业内部的其他系统如ERP、PLM、SCADA等进行集成,以实现生产过程的全面监控和协同。集成层是 MES 系统底层架构中的另一个重要部分,它通过各种接口和协议与其他系统进行数据交换和信息共享。集成层的设计和实现直接影响 MES 系统整体的稳定性、可靠性和扩展性。 -
应用层:
应用层是 MES 软件系统的核心功能区域,包括生产计划排程、物料管理、过程监控、质量管理、设备维护等功能模块。应用层负责实现 MES 系统的具体业务逻辑和功能,为用户提供各种工具和界面来监控和管理生产过程。应用层的设计应兼顾功能的全面性和易用性,以满足用户在不同层次和角色下的需求。 -
安全层:
安全层是 MES 软件系统底层架构中至关重要的部分,负责保障系统的安全性和稳定性。安全层包括身份认证、权限管理、数据加密、防火墙和入侵检测等机制,以防止未授权访问和数据泄露。安全层的设计和实施需要综合考虑系统的整体风险和安全需求,确保 MES 系统的正常运行和数据的保密性。 -
分布式架构:
随着制造业的数字化转型和生产的复杂性增加,MES 系统需求具备高可扩展性和灵活性。因此,许多现代的 MES 软件系统采用分布式架构来实现系统的部署和扩展。分布式架构允许 MES 系统在多个服务器上部署,实现负载均衡和容错处理,提高系统的性能和可靠性。同时,分布式架构也为 MES 系统的未来发展提供了更多的可能性和机会。
通过以上介绍,可以看出 MES 软件系统底层架构涵盖了数据库层、集成层、应用层、安全层和分布式架构等多个关键组成部分,这些层面的设计和实现直接影响着 MES 系统的功能性、稳定性和性能,值得制造企业在选型和部署时进行深入考量和评估。
1年前 -
















































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》









领先企业,真实声音
简道云让业务用户感受数字化的效果,加速数字化落地;零代码快速开发迭代提供了很低的试错成本,孵化了一批新工具新方法。
郑炯蒙牛乳业信息技术高级总监
简道云把各模块数据整合到一起,工作效率得到质的提升。现在赛艇协会遇到新的业务需求时,会直接用简道云开发demo,基本一天完成。
谭威正中国赛艇协会数据总监
业务与技术交织,让思维落地实现。四年简道云使用经历,功能越来越多也反推业务流程转变,是促使我们成长的过程。实现了真正降本增效。
袁超OPPO(苏皖)信息化部门负责人
零代码的无门槛开发方式盘活了全公司信息化推进的热情和效率,简道云打破了原先集团的数据孤岛困局,未来将继续向数据要生产力。
伍学纲东方日升新能源股份有限公司副总裁
通过简道云零代码技术的运用实践,提高了企业转型速度、减少对高技术专业人员的依赖。在应用推广上,具备员工上手快的竞争优势。
董兴潮绿城建筑科技集团信息化专业经理
简道云是目前最贴合我们实际业务的信息化产品。通过灵活的自定义平台,实现了信息互通、闭环管理,企业管理效率真正得到了提升。
王磊克吕士科学仪器(上海)有限公司总经理